Output ef296733c341ba55ebaabb243b4e005bfb61640d84539109bfe00fe63737c553:0

value
28295057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0beeed8fded6db3ffe00f0041f6661973dde003 OP_EQUAL
address
3GLxmVbqkhMeNTxLaMqgCtX9bfd2Vkh91s
transaction
ef296733c341ba55ebaabb243b4e005bfb61640d84539109bfe00fe63737c553